This pair of 1940s American butterfly wingback armchairs embodies the sculptural elegance of early mid-century upholstery, defined by sweeping silhouettes and deep, enveloping wings. The original floral textile—an oversized botanical pattern rendered in soft greens, blush pinks, and muted ivory—evokes the romantic domestic style of the period, offering both historical atmosphere and visual presence. The chairs rest on shaped wooden legs that reinforce their generous stance, while the tall backs and wide seats reflect a design language rooted in comfort and gracious living. As a matched pair, they form a commanding statement for a layered interior, blending mid-century form with the nostalgia of preserved period upholstery. Measurements: 43.5"H x 31"W x 31" D Seating height: 17.5"/ Seat Width: 30" / Seat Depth: 21" /26.5" Arm height Weight: 50 lb Origin: USA Age: 1940's
